中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

C#中使用iText如何進行PDF合并

c#
小樊
130
2024-08-21 23:15:29
欄目: 編程語言

在C#中使用iText進行PDF合并,可以按照以下步驟進行:

  1. 首先需要安裝iTextSharp庫,可以通過NuGet包管理器進行安裝。

  2. 創建一個新的PDF文檔對象,用于存儲合并后的PDF文件。

Document newDocument = new Document();
PdfCopy copy = new PdfCopy(newDocument, new FileStream("merged.pdf", FileMode.Create));
newDocument.Open();
  1. 循環讀取需要合并的PDF文件,并將其逐個添加到新的PDF文檔中。
string[] pdfFiles = { "file1.pdf", "file2.pdf", "file3.pdf" };

foreach (string pdfFile in pdfFiles)
{
    PdfReader reader = new PdfReader(pdfFile);
    copy.AddDocument(reader);
    reader.Close();
}
  1. 最后關閉新的PDF文檔對象,完成合并操作。
newDocument.Close();

通過以上步驟,就可以使用iTextSharp庫在C#中進行PDF文件的合并操作。需要注意的是,合并的PDF文件需要保證頁面大小和方向一致,否則可能會出現排版錯誤。

0
崇信县| 连城县| 肃北| 武山县| 临颍县| 鄢陵县| 理塘县| 麻阳| 慈利县| 白沙| 泗洪县| 修水县| 临西县| 容城县| 宜兴市| 兴业县| 延边| 体育| 湟源县| 策勒县| 太和县| 资源县| 南皮县| 辽阳市| 邵武市| 隆尧县| 碌曲县| 武平县| 高碑店市| 桂阳县| 星座| 永城市| 遵义县| 望奎县| 邵东县| 灵石县| 城口县| 峨眉山市| 邯郸县| 宁化县| 莱州市|